It’s important to get the ideal ratio of liquid to flour to produce tangzhong. If way too minor liquid is added, Then you certainly chance building gluten in the flour while you stir it. The magic ratio is 5 pieces liquid to 1 section flour. You should utilize all drinking water, all milk or 50 % milk and fifty percent h2o way too. I choose to have a mix of The 2. I increase the flour into a saucepan, then add 50 percent the level of drinking water. Then I whisk it To combine the flour properly and to be certain there won't be any lumps. Next, I incorporate the rest of the liquid (drinking water and/or milk), and stir to mix. Then I cook the mixture until eventually I get a nice, thick pudding-like roux. After the tangzhong is cooked, I transfer it to some bowl and canopy the floor with plastic wrap.
